M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
reviews
issues
regarding open
education resources
and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
evolvements in
online learning are empowering
humans
in all parts of the world
to be participants in online classes.
These online MOOCs are
customarily free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
There are numerous
subjects that
online learning technology institutions
have to consider
now that distance learning technology is
improving so fast.
How can organizations
make sure that
the quality of these
massively open online courses is
acceptable?
